Request for Proposal: School Site Visit Coordinator

PURPOSE:

A successful contractor will coordinate the completion of 17 formative reviews, based on the criteria in the Commission’s Annual School Site Visit Protocol for the schools in the Commission’s portfolio. The visits will take place between October and April.

The majority of the visits will be on site and must include observing a board meeting. Some of the visits may be virtual depending on the specific circumstances of the school.

Request for Proposal: City Visit

PURPOSE:
The purpose of this RFP is to solicit proposals from individuals/teams experienced working with charter school authorizers to assist the Missouri Charter Public School Commission in the planning and delivery of a visit to Indianapolis, Indiana in the spring of 2023. The purpose of the multiday visit is to create an opportunity for meaningful dialogue and generate innovative ideas from members of the charter school sector similar to the cities of MCPSC sponsored schools. We anticipate 18-22 participants.

REQUEST FOR QUALIFICATIONS: CLOSURE COORDINATOR

 

The Missouri Charter Public School Commission is seeking responses to our Request for Qualification for the role of Closure Coordinator, in the event we need this work in the 2023 or 2024 school years.  

The typical scope of work is detailed in the Closure Manual,  Part IV: Closure Plan.  The Closure Coordinator fees are all inclusive (fees, travel and expenses) and are set at $30,000 for a successful completion of a school closure.

Request for Bids: School Quality Review for Transfer - La Salle Charter School

By March 31, 2022 a successful contractor will conduct a summative review, report and provide feedback, based on the criteria in the Commission’s School Quality Review (SQR) Protocol LaSalle Charter School whose sponsorship has been transferred to MCPSC.  

LaSalle Charter School will transfer to MCPSC on January 1, 2022.  The school serves approximately 100 students in grades 6-8 and is in year 2 of a five year contract.  The information provided by the SQR on operations, finance and academics will be used to provide baseline report for the Commission.
